    We ordered steel casters for material carts. Unfortunately when we received them, they were not going to work with these carts. I contacted the company in less than 30 days to see about returning them and was told that their Return Policy is 21 days. There is nothing on any of their communications (from their Order Confirmation, Shipping Confirmation to their Invoice) to indicate that their Return Policy is less than the typical 30 Days. Most companies purchase items thinking they will work and do not look into the number of days for a Return Policy. We were disappointed that they were not willing to work with us on this return request since we were only a few days past their 21 Day Return Policy.

    This company is affiliated with or has same owners with company Durabox that sells mail drop boxes branded by them through multiple resellers including Amazon.

    Earlier this year we purchased 3 drop boxes from DuraBox through Amazon for apartment complexes in *****.
    The drop box model we bough was:

    Everywhere this product is listed, it's advertised as SECURE (they use caps).
    Specifically, they say:
    SECURE - Features a tubular style key lock with 2 tubular keys that are difficult to copy. Security baffle on drop slot prevents fishing, and a continuous piano hinge on the retrieval door makes it difficult to pry.

    Shortly after we installed them, checks and money orders for more than 17k dropped in by tenants were stolen from two out of three properties over the weekend. We have informed the seller in writing on 7/4/22 providing full details and police reports that their product is NOT secure and money orders were pulled out using technique called "fishing" against which seller claimed the boxes were protected. Our letter sent by certified mail as well as notices sent through web sites and emails were ignored. We spoke to the representative at digitalbuyer.com and were promised that information sent through web forms will be passed ** the management. Nothing happened.

    Out of 17k stolen, we were able to recover 7 and still have a loss of 10k.
    We lost it because of false advertisement by the seller and reliance on false claim of security.
    We request a reimbursement of losses and for this product to be removed from sale or removal of the claim about it 's security.
